Romelu Lukaku returned to Inter’s training ground in Appiano Gentile today as he continues working towards a return in the upcoming clash against Udinese.

The 29-year-old Belgian forward started the season well under Simone Inzaghi, scoring a goal and providing an assist in the opening three games, but he was forced to the sidelines after suffering from muscle issues, which left him unavailable for the derby defeat to Milan, as well as the loss to Bayern Munich.

As reported by Calciomercato.com, Lukaku returned to Appiano Gentile today after spending the last few days in Belgium undergoing a new round of medical checks. The Belgian continued his recovery programme at the Inter training ground, working individually as the club carefully manage his condition.

The Chelsea loanee is pushing hard to try and be fit in time for next weekend’s clash against Udinese, so he won’t take part in the upcoming Champions League game against Viktoria Plzen.
